Anton Blok Anton Blok (born 1935 in Amsterdam) is an anthropologist, famous for studying the Mafia in Sicily in 1960s. Anton Blok was a visiting professor at the University of Michigan (1972-1973) and University of California, Berkeley in 1988. He is a professor ''emeritus'' of cultural anthropology at the University of Amsterdam. He also spent one semester at Yale as a fellow. ==Select bibliography==
